From: Stephan Bosch Date: Sun, 8 Apr 2018 13:24:02 +0000 (+0200) Subject: lib-smtp: test-smtp-server-errors: Add log prefixes for client and server. X-Git-Tag: 2.3.2.rc1~148 X-Git-Url: http://git.ipfire.org/?a=commitdiff_plain;h=d45a77f390e13d0f6479d5cb478f67c974712e4a;p=thirdparty%2Fdovecot%2Fcore.git lib-smtp: test-smtp-server-errors: Add log prefixes for client and server. Makes it easier to distinguish which process is sending a log message while debugging. --- diff --git a/src/lib-smtp/test-smtp-server-errors.c b/src/lib-smtp/test-smtp-server-errors.c index 1407242bca..d1bddbcd9f 100644 --- a/src/lib-smtp/test-smtp-server-errors.c +++ b/src/lib-smtp/test-smtp-server-errors.c @@ -1502,6 +1502,8 @@ static void test_run_client_server( { unsigned int i; + i_set_failure_prefix("SERVER: "); + client_pids = NULL; client_pids_count = 0; @@ -1519,9 +1521,10 @@ static void test_run_client_server( if (client_pids[i] == 0) { client_pids[i] = (pid_t)-1; client_pids_count = 0; + i_set_failure_prefix("CLIENT[%d]: ", i+1); hostpid_init(); if (debug) - i_debug("client[%d]: PID=%s", i+1, my_pid); + i_debug("PID=%s", my_pid); /* child: client */ usleep(100000); /* wait a little for server setup */ i_close_fd(&fd_listen); @@ -1537,7 +1540,7 @@ static void test_run_client_server( } } if (debug) - i_debug("server: PID=%s", my_pid); + i_debug("PID=%s", my_pid); } /* parent: server */